The handbook of alternative assets merges the data ans strategies of four key alternative asset classes into one hand guide for the serious investor this concise handbook classifies four types of alternative assets hedge funds, commodity and manged futures, private equity, and credit derivatives and shows how these assets can be used to hedge and expand any portfolio
